Korean Actress Jung Ga-eun Opens Up About Remarriage and Parenting

Korean actress Jung Ga-eun recently hinted at the possibility of remarriage.

On October 12, the YouTube channel 'Yujeong and Jujeong' released a video titled 'How Far Can a Single Mom's Escapade Go?' featuring Jung Ga-eun.

During the episode, Seo Yoo-jung posed a hypothetical question about dating and marriage, asking, "Would you prefer a wealthy 80-year-old or a peer-aged TV producer?" Jung Ga-eun humorously responded, "Money isn't everything. However, if an 80-year-old gentleman likes me, I would respect him," causing laughter.

Both Jung Ga-eun and Seo Yoo-jung, who are mothers raising daughters, shared a deep connection. Jung Ga-eun recalled visiting Seo Yoo-jung twice in Songdo and taking care of her daughter when she was sick.

Seo Yoo-jung expressed her gratitude, saying, "During that challenging time, Ga-eun brought food and took care of my daughter, Song-i. I considered her a parenting mentor and was very thankful. I can't forget her kindness."

The conversation also touched on their daughters' pride in their mothers' fame. Jung Ga-eun shared, "When I pick up my daughter from her academy, she proudly says, 'My mom is a celebrity.'" She added, "In the elevator, she suddenly announces, 'My mom is Jung Ga-eun,'" sharing her daughter's adorable pride.

Seo Yoo-jung shared a similar experience, recalling, "Someone recognized me and greeted me, and my daughter, Song-i, grabbed her friend's hand and said, 'That's my mom.'" She also recounted a story where her daughter asked, "Are you an actress, mom?" and then declared, "I want to be an actress when I grow up."

However, both actresses agreed that they would be hesitant if their daughters wanted to pursue a career in entertainment. Jung Ga-eun stated, "I don't want to encourage it. It would be better if they had other skills." She continued, "Being in the public eye means enduring scrutiny. While following the law is a given, there's a constant pressure to be a role model. I don't want to impose that burden on my child."

Jung Ga-eun, who married a businessman in 2016 and divorced in 2018, is currently raising her daughter alone. She has recently started working as a taxi driver and obtained a financial planner certification, drawing public attention.
